Frequently Asked Questions
What kinds of tours are available near Wilmington?
Options range from walking historical tours through downtown’s scenic streets to boat and kayak tours exploring the Cape Fear River and surrounding marshlands.
Are the tours suitable for families with kids?
Yes, many tours are family-friendly with options designed for all ages, including shorter walks and boat rides that accommodate children.
What wildlife might I see on a sightseeing tour?
Expect to encounter wading birds like herons and egrets, occasional deer along river edges, and in marsh areas, you might spot turtles and crabs actively moving.
Is tipping expected for guided tours?
While not mandatory, it is customary and appreciated to tip guides who provide engaging, informative experiences.
Are tours accessible year-round?
Most tours operate year-round, though availability and conditions vary with the seasons; summers are busiest, while winter offers quieter exploration.
Can I book private or customized tours?
Many local operators offer private tours that can be tailored to your interests, from photography-focus to historical deep-dives.

Local Insights
Hidden Gems
- "Battery Park overlooking the Cape Fear River offers less crowded, stunning sunset views."
- "Greenfield Lake trails provide peaceful forested paths seldom found in the downtown district."
Wildlife
- "Look for the elusive Red-cockaded Woodpecker in nearby Longleaf pine habitats."
- "Ospreys and bald eagles are commonly seen nesting near coastal waterways."
History
"Wilmington’s role as a key port during the Civil War and its preserved historic district offer vivid insights into America’s southern heritage."
